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Edición de atributos del equilibrador de carga de red
Después de crear el equilibrador de carga de red, puede editar sus atributos.
Atributos del equilibrador de carga
Protección contra eliminación
Para evitar que el equilibrador de carga de red se elimine por error, puede habilitar la protección contra eliminación. De manera predeterminada, la protección contra eliminación del equilibrador de carga de red está deshabilitada.
Si habilita la protección contra eliminación del equilibrador de carga de red, deberá deshabilitarla para poder eliminarlo.
Equilibrio de carga entre zonas
Con los equilibradores de carga de red, el equilibrio de carga entre zonas está desactivado de forma predeterminada en el nivel del equilibrador de carga, pero puede activarlo en cualquier momento. Para los grupos de destino, la configuración del equilibrador de carga está predeterminada, pero puede anularla activando o desactivando explícitamente el equilibrio de carga entre zonas al nivel del grupo de destino. Para obtener más información, consulte Equilibrio de carga entre zonas para grupos de destino.
Afinidad de DNS de la zona de disponibilidad
Si utiliza la política de enrutamiento de clientes predeterminada, las solicitudes que se envíen al nombre de DNS del equilibrador de carga de red recibirán cualquier dirección IP del equilibrador de carga de red que esté en buen estado. Esto hace que se distribuyan las conexiones de los clientes entre las zonas de disponibilidad del equilibrador de carga de red. Con las políticas de enrutamiento por afinidad de zona de disponibilidad, las consultas de DNS de los clientes prefieren las direcciones IP de los equilibradores de carga de red de su propia zona de disponibilidad. Esto ayuda a mejorar tanto la latencia como la resiliencia, ya que los clientes no necesitan cruzar los límites de la zona de disponibilidad para conectarse a los destinos.
Las políticas de enrutamiento por afinidad de zona de disponibilidad solo se aplican a los clientes que resuelven el nombre de DNS del equilibrador de carga de red mediante Route 53 Resolver. Para obtener más información, consulte ¿Qué es Amazon Route 53 Resolver? en la Guía para desarrolladores de Amazon Route 53.
Políticas de enrutamiento de clientes disponibles para los equilibradores de carga de red que utilizan Route 53 Resolver:
-
Afinidad de zona de disponibilidad: afinidad de zona del 100 por ciento
Las consultas de DNS de los clientes darán preferencia a la dirección IP del equilibrador de carga de red de su propia zona de disponibilidad. Las consultas se pueden resolver en otras zonas si no existen direcciones IP del equilibrador de carga de red en buen estado de su propia zona.
-
Afinidad de zona de disponibilidad parcial: afinidad de zona del 85 por ciento
El 85 % de las consultas de DNS de los clientes darán preferencia a las direcciones IP del equilibrador de carga de red de su propia zona de disponibilidad, mientras que el resto de las consultas se resuelven en cualquier zona en buen estado. Es posible que las consultas se dirijan a otras zonas en buen estado si no hay ninguna IPs en buen estado en su zona. Si no hay ningún estado IPs en buen estado en ninguna zona, las consultas se resuelven en cualquier zona.
-
Cualquier zona de disponibilidad (predeterminada): afinidad de zona del 0 por ciento
Las consultas de DNS de los clientes se resuelven entre las direcciones IP del equilibrador de carga de red en buen estado en todas las zonas de disponibilidad del equilibrador de carga de red.
La afinidad de zona de disponibilidad ayuda a enrutar las solicitudes del cliente al equilibrador de carga de red, mientras que el equilibrio de carga entre zonas se utiliza para ayudar a enrutar las solicitudes desde el equilibrador de carga hacia los destinos. Cuando se utiliza la afinidad de zona de disponibilidad, se debe desactivar el equilibrio de carga entre zonas; esto garantiza que el tráfico del equilibrador de carga de red desde los clientes hacia los destinos permanezca dentro de la misma zona de disponibilidad. Con esta configuración, el tráfico de los clientes se envía a la zona de disponibilidad del mismo equilibrador de carga de red, por lo que se recomienda configurar la aplicación para que escale de manera independiente en cada zona de disponibilidad. Esta consideración es importante cuando el número de clientes por cada zona de disponibilidad o el tráfico por cada zona de disponibilidad no son iguales. Para obtener más información, consulte Equilibrio de carga entre zonas para grupos de destino.
Cuando se considera que una zona de disponibilidad se encuentra en mal estado o cuando se inicia un cambio de zona, la dirección IP de zona se considerará en mal estado y no se devolverá a los clientes a menos que se produzca un error de apertura. La afinidad de zona de disponibilidad se mantiene cuando se produce un error al abrir el registro de DNS. Esto ayuda a mantener la independencia de las zonas de disponibilidad y a evitar posibles errores entre las zonas.
Cuando se utiliza la afinidad de zona de disponibilidad, se esperan tiempos de desequilibrio entre las zonas de disponibilidad. Se recomienda asegurarse de que los destinos se escalen a nivel de zona para admitir la carga de trabajo de cada zona de disponibilidad. En los casos en que estos desequilibrios sean significativos, se recomienda desactivar la afinidad de zona de disponibilidad. Esto permite una distribución uniforme de las conexiones de los clientes entre todas las zonas de disponibilidad del equilibrador de carga de red en 60 segundos, o el TTL de DNS.
Antes de utilizar la afinidad de zona de disponibilidad, tenga en cuenta lo siguiente:
-
La afinidad de zona de disponibilidad provoca cambios en todos los clientes de los equilibradores de carga de red que utilizan Route 53 Resolver.
-
Los clientes no pueden decidir entre las resoluciones de DNS locales de la zona y de varias zonas. La afinidad de zona de disponibilidad decide por ellos.
-
Los clientes no disponen de un método fiable para determinar cuándo se ven afectados por la afinidad de zona de disponibilidad ni cómo saber qué dirección IP se encuentra en cada zona de disponibilidad.
-
-
Si utilizan la afinidad entre zonas de disponibilidad con Network Load Balancers y Route 53 Resolver, recomendamos a los clientes que utilicen el punto final de entrada de Route 53 Resolver en su propia zona de disponibilidad.
-
Los clientes permanecerán asignados a su dirección IP local de la zona hasta que se considere que se encuentra en mal estado en función de las comprobaciones de estado del DNS y se elimine del DNS.
-
El uso de la afinidad de zona de disponibilidad con el equilibrio de carga entre zonas activado puede provocar una distribución desequilibrada de las conexiones de los clientes entre las zonas de disponibilidad. Se recomienda configurar la pila de aplicaciones para que se escale de forma independiente en cada zona de disponibilidad, a fin de garantizar que pueda admitir el tráfico de clientes de zona.
-
Si el equilibrio de carga entre zonas se encuentra activado, el equilibrador de carga de red está sujeto a un impacto entre zonas.
-
La carga en cada una de las zonas de disponibilidad de los equilibradores de carga de red será proporcional a las ubicaciones de zona de las solicitudes de los clientes. Si no configura cuántos clientes se ejecutan en cada zona de disponibilidad, tendrá que escalar de forma independiente cada zona de disponibilidad de forma reactiva.
Monitorización
Se recomienda realizar un seguimiento de la distribución de las conexiones entre las zonas de disponibilidad mediante las métricas del equilibrador de carga de red de la zona. Puede utilizar las métricas para ver la cantidad de conexiones nuevas y activas por zona.
Recomendamos que realice un seguimiento de lo siguiente:
-
ActiveFlowCount
: la cantidad total de flujos (o conexiones) simultáneos de clientes a destinos. -
NewFlowCount
: la cantidad total de flujos (o conexiones) nuevos establecidos desde los clientes a los destinos en el periodo indicado. -
HealthyHostCount
: la cantidad de destinos que se considera que se encuentran en buen estado. -
UnHealthyHostCount
: la cantidad de destinos que se considera que no se encuentran en buen estado.
Para obtener más información, consulte CloudWatch métricas para su Network Load Balancer
Habilite la afinidad entre zonas de disponibilidad
Direcciones IP secundarias
Si se producen errores en la asignación de puertos y no puede añadir destinos al grupo de destino para resolverlos, puede añadir direcciones IP secundarias a las interfaces de red del equilibrador de carga. Para cada zona en la que el balanceador de carga esté habilitado, seleccionamos IPv4 direcciones de la subred del balanceador de carga y las asignamos a la interfaz de red correspondiente. Estas direcciones IP secundarias se utilizan para establecer conexiones con los destinos. También se utilizan para comprobar el estado del tráfico. Para empezar, le recomendamos que añada una dirección IP secundaria, supervise la PortAllocationErrors
métrica y añada otra dirección IP secundaria solo si no se resuelven los errores de asignación de puertos.
aviso
Después de añadir las direcciones IP secundarias, no podrá eliminarlas. La única forma de liberar las direcciones IP secundarias es eliminar el balanceador de cargas. Antes de añadir direcciones IP secundarias, comprueba que haya suficientes IPv4 direcciones disponibles en las subredes del balanceador de carga.